The STEINWAY CROWN JEWEL COLLECTION is an exclusive series of spectacular STEINWAYS that feature particularly fine veneers. High-quality Mahogany, Walnut, Kewazinga Bubinga, East Indian Rosewood, Macassar Ebony, and other veneers are available.
Kewazinga Bubinga is a highly desirable wood from West Africa. Its unique, richly contrasting grain and soft, bright sheen give this piano a wonderful lightness and irresistible charm.

Figured Sycamore is a maple by genetic makeup and is among the most valuable native broad-leafed trees in Europe. Nearly white in color with a fine, notable uniform structure, and straight grain that may be figured, this light color wood evokes a minimalist elegance.

Indian Apple, also known as Tineo is found primarily in South America and is prized for its unique pinkish-brown veneer marked with bold dark streaks, typically black but sometimes of an exotic dark green, blue or purple.
